The history of Kiowa is a narrative of grit and resourcefulness, deeply entwined with the veins of coal that once pulsed beneath this very ground. For generations, the rhythm of life here was dictated by the clang of pickaxes and the rumble of mine carts, a legacy that has subtly shaped the character of its people, instilling a quiet resilience. Though the mines have largely fallen silent, the echoes of that industrial past remain, a spectral presence in the weathered facades of older buildings and the stoic countenances of those who call Kiowa home. The local economy, now diversified and evolving, still draws strength from the fertile land, with agriculture and small businesses weaving a new chapter into the enduring story of this Pittsburg County settlement.
